Executive - QC - Instrument
Job Description:
1. Review overall QC documents.
2. Prepare training modules as required and provide training to QC staff.
3. Initiate and approve analyst qualifications as needed.
4. Approve COAs for water analysis from the microbiology department.
5. Review microbiological analytical reports, raw data sheets, and inward registers for finished
products.
6. Prepare and validate Excel sheet calculations.
7. Ensure all necessary testing and calibration are performed as per established procedures and
specifications.
8. Ensure regulatory compliance related to the QC department.
9. Review maintenance records of analytical instruments, facilities, and related documents.
10. Review validation activities, including analytical test procedures, instruments, and calibration
of control equipment.
11. Conduct stability studies as per ICH guidelines and review related records.
12. Update final product specifications as per statutory requirements.
13. Propose new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and analytical instruments, ensuring their
establishment and implementation.
14. Review documents related to reserve retain samples and periodic observations.
15. Review or prepare Certificates of Analysis (COAs) for released finished products.
16. Ensure Annual Maintenance Contracts (AMCs) for instruments are in place with valid
timelines.
17. Verify and confirm electronic data/metadata of instrumental analysis as required.
18. Review and verify chromatograms, audit trails of HPLC/UHPLC/GC/UV/FTIR, and stability
data.
19. Participate in GMP audits and related activities.
20. Review analytical data on a daily/monthly basis and take corrective actions or investigate plant
processes.
21. Handle change control, deviations, and incidents.
